CONTROLS AND FEATURES

Overheat Indicator

Multi-function Display
OVERHEAT
INDICATOR
(RED)
When the alert triggers, the
overheat indicator comes on and
the buzzer sounds a steady tone
as the engine speed is reduced to
1,800 rpm. If the condition
persists for another 20 seconds,
the engine shuts off. Refer to
TAKING CARE OF UNEXPECTED
PROBLEMS, on P.124.

All models are equipped with a
buzzer that sounds continuously
when the red overheat indicator
light comes on.
Engine overheating may be the
result of clogged water intakes.

Cooling System Indicator

COOLING SYSTEM INDICATOR
Water should flow from the
cooling system indicator while
the engine is running. This shows
that water is circulating through
the cooling system.
If water stops flowing while the
engine is running, it indicates a
cooling system problem, such as
clogged water intakes, which will
cause engine overheating.
